Course Content

• Sustainable Packaging Design Principles & Life Cycle Assessment
• Composite Materials Science for Packaging: Polymers, Fibers, Additives
• Manufacturing Processes for Composite Packaging: Injection Molding, Thermoforming, etc.
• Bio-based and Biodegradable Composites for Sustainable Packaging
• Mechanical and Barrier Properties of Composite Packaging Materials
• Packaging Regulations and Sustainability Certifications (e.g., compostable, recyclable)
• Circular Economy Principles in Composite Packaging
• Advanced Composite Materials for Food Packaging: Barrier & Safety
• Case Studies in Sustainable Composite Packaging Innovations
• Cost Analysis and Business Strategies for Sustainable Composite Packaging

Career path

Career Role (Sustainable Packaging & Composite Materials) Description
Composite Materials Engineer Develop and optimize sustainable composite materials for packaging applications, focusing on lifecycle analysis and recyclability. Strong problem-solving skills essential.
Packaging Technologist (Bio-composites) Research, design, and test innovative bio-based composite packaging solutions, ensuring functionality and eco-friendliness. Expertise in material science crucial.
Sustainability Consultant (Packaging) Advise companies on sustainable packaging practices, including composite material selection and waste reduction strategies. Requires strong communication and analytical skills.
Research Scientist (Polymer Composites) Conduct research into new sustainable polymer composites for packaging, focusing on performance and environmental impact. A PhD in a relevant field is preferred.
Production Manager (Sustainable Packaging) Oversee the manufacturing process of sustainable composite packaging, ensuring quality, efficiency, and environmental compliance. Strong leadership and management skills required.
